Output 02828d66aef41f2ad1fcb2e3106e9cf4a2c84398d3059c8eced409ab2c08f317:1

value
11566780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36ecdf4123d67cbac581f93a6c358c8cb0187946 OP_EQUAL
address
36hSB4epADk682nMPfAdLj5Arv6Qf7pfwx
transaction
02828d66aef41f2ad1fcb2e3106e9cf4a2c84398d3059c8eced409ab2c08f317
spent
true